Queens RCMP Lay Firearm Theft Charges Following Break and Enter

Queens County RCMP executed a search warrant on November 15, after months of investigation into a break-and-enter that took place in August at a home Mooers Road in Milton.

The execution of the search warrant which took place at a home on M Smith Road in White Point saw a 27 year-old man and a 25 year-old woman get arrested.

Investigators recovered several stolen firearms, ammunition, and other stolen property.

The pair now both face charges of; Possession of a Weapon Obtained by the Commission of an Offence, Careless Storage of a Firearm, Unsafe Storage of a Firearm, and Possession of Stolen Property.

The man who was arrested is also facing some additional charges which include;

  • Breaking and Entering to Steal a Firearm;
  • Break, Enter and Commit;
  • Unsafe Storage of a Firearm (3 counts);
  • Unauthorized Possession of a Firearm Knowing Possession is Unauthorized;
  • Possession of Weapon Obtained by the Commission of an Offence;
  • Tampering with a Serial Number;
  • Theft under $5,000;
  • Mischief under $5,000;
  • Failure to Comply with Conditions of an Undertaking (2 counts)

The woman who was arrested has since been released and will appear in Bridgewater Provincial Court at a later date, while the man was remanded into custody.
